Police were investigating reports that a World War Two shell has been found in central London today.
Officers were called by members of the public who suspected they had found the rusting casing of a shell in Lambeth.
Part of Westminster Bridge Road between Morley Street and Gerridge Street, a short distance from the Imperial War Museum, was closed.
A Metropolitan Police spokesman confirmed officers were at the scene investigating reports that explosives had been found.
